HC Deb 11 June 1990 vol 174 cc45-6W
90. Mr. David Martin

To ask the Minister for the Arts what major arts bodies have relocated to the regions in the last three years; and if he will make a statement.

Mr. Luce

Detailed information about the relocation of arts organisations is not held centrally. I am aware, however, that a number of major arts organisations are moving all or part of their operations to the regions. They include the transfer of the Sadlers Wells Royal Ballet to Birmingham; the extension of the Tate gallery's range of activities to Liverpool and, in the future, to Cornwall; and the opening by the science museum of the national museum of film, photography and television in Bradford.

I welcome these and other developments which ensure that the best of British arts is accessible to the widest possible public.
